The low growing sedum plants may spread several feet but only grow a few inches high. Upright yellow flowers grow 6-8 inches tall in early summer. 'Angelina' is the cultivar name. Vigorous and dependable, it will grow over a foot wide in a season. Plant taxonomy classifies Angelina stonecrop as Sedum rupestre 'Angelina.' An easy-care plant that makes a statement, 'Angelina' has bright golden foliage that turns orange in fall. This foliage is evergreen in warmer climates, but in cooler climates the foliage turns an orange to burgundy color in autumn and winter. Check your plants regularly to make sure they are not too dry and water (sparingly) if needed. Angelina stonecrop needs regular watering after you first plant it. About the Sedums: These perennial plants enjoy gritty, fast-draining soil, and must have full hot sun.They're really desert plants, so give them sharp drainage. In fact, heavy clay soil or other waterlogged sites can kill the plant. wide. Like other sedums plants, once established, it will become drought resistant, making Angelina excellent for use in xeriscaped beds, rock gardens, sandy sites, firescaping, or spilling over stone walls or containers.
